Unlocking the Secrets of Shredding the Demonic: 5 Essential Chords
To master the art of shredding, one must first understand the fundamental chords that form the foundation of this complex technique. Here are five essential chords to tackle ‘unholy confessions’ on guitar:
- The E5 Power Chord
- The B5 Power Chord
- The C#5 Power Chord
- The A5 Power Chord
- The D#5 Power Chord
Mechanics of Shredding the Demonic
Shredding the demonic involves a range of techniques, from picking and strumming to bending and sliding. By mastering these basic techniques, musicians can create complex and intricate sounds that form the foundation of shredding.
One of the key elements of shredding is the use of chromatic passing tones. These passing tones add an extra layer of tension and release to the music, creating a sense of drama and emotion.
